Mazda continues to innovate new and user-friendly technology for their vehicles, such as the key fob. This handy device lets you start your vehicle or access it with the push of a key. If it does go out of commission while you're out and about in Stroudsburg, Easton, or Brodheadsville You'll need to be aware of how to open the Mazda key fob to change its battery.

First take the metal auxiliary key from the side of the Mazda key fob case. You'll notice two slots on each side of the case. Use a tape-wrapped flathead screwdriver to open the case, being careful not to scratch or snap it. Remove the battery that was in use and replace it with a new one, making sure the positive (+) side of the battery is facing upwards.
